Safety First
While ear rubbing is generally a safe and enjoyable activity, it's important to keep a few things in mind. First, always approach your dog with care, especially if they are sensitive or anxious. Use gentle strokes and be mindful of their body language. Second, make sure you're not causing any pain or discomfort. If your dog flinches or pulls away, it's a sign to take a break. Lastly, if you notice any redness, swelling, or discharge from your dog's ears, it's best to consult a veterinarian.
The Benefits of Ear Rubbing
In addition to the immediate pleasure your dog will experience, ear rubbing offers several long-term benefits. For one, it can help you keep a closer eye on your pup's ears, which is important for early detection of any issues like infections or allergies. It's also a great way to bond with your dog, reducing stress and anxiety levels for both of you. How to Get Started
If you're new to ear rubbing, here are a few tips to help you get started:
1. Choose a comfortable spot where you and your dog can relax without interruption.
2. Gently rub your dog's ears using the palm of your hand or a soft cloth.
3. Pay attention to the area behind the ear, as this is often the most sensitive spot.
4. Keep the strokes gentle and soothing, avoiding any sudden movements.
5. Take breaks if your dog seems uncomfortable or overwhelmed.
